Master of Arts in Cultural Studies in Education:
This program is designed for graduate students who are interested in learning about diversity in today's schools. The program focuses on consciousness, racial differences, and cross-cultural education. The program also covers issues such as religion and gender. The program begins with core education theories and concepts. Students participate in discussions with learning groups made of students and faculty members. Students may choose individual areas of study. Students may also participate in internships that allow them to practically apply the ideas and theories learned in the classroom.
Master of Arts in Physical Education Teacher Education:
This program is for students who are interested in teaching health and physical wellness in schools. The program contains all of the components of a core teaching education. Students learn about theories and methods that have been proven to work in the classroom. They learn how to promote health consciousness, and they also learn about new technology and media being used in this exciting field. Students participate in internships that allow them to get experience teaching physical education. Students who complete this program develop innovative and effective ways to bring health and wellness to today's schools.
